Long-haul budget carrier Norse Atlantic Airways has partnered with airline distributor Air Promotion Group to make its flights available through global distribution systems (GDSs).
The agreement allows Norse Atlantic to distribute its content through the APG Interline E-Ticketing (IET) system to “all major GDS platforms worldwide”, which includes Amadeus, Sabre and Travelport.
The Norway-based carrier’s flights will be displayed under the A1 code via a “pseudo codeshare agreement”, the companies said in a statement. Norse Atlantic’s content is also available for agencies to book via APG Connect, which is APG’s B2B platform.
